Chapter 9: The Butterfly Effect – Life from the Ashes

The final stage of the Junior Breeding License Exam was held in the "Life-Forge Hall," a high-tech laboratory with thousands of spectators watching from the balcony. Each candidate was presented with a container. Most held healthy, common pets like Iron-Rats or Fire-Chicks.

When Leo opened his container, a collective gasp echoed through the hall.

Inside lay a Limp-Winged Butterfly, its translucent wings tattered and dry. Its mana-core was flickering like a dying candle. It wasn't just "trash"; it was dying.

"This is a mistake!" Samuel shouted from the stands. "That pet has less than an hour to live!"

Marcus Vance laughed from three tables away, already preparing expensive lightning-stones for his Hawk. "Looks like the 'Genius' finally ran out of luck. Even a Heart can't breed a corpse."

The Sovereign's Decision

The Head Examiner, Master-Breeder Silas, looked down from the podium. "Candidate Leo Heart, due to a clerical error in the procurement of test subjects, you may request a replacement pet. This Butterfly is beyond medical help."

Leo looked at the small creature. With Sovereign's Insight, he saw what no one else could.

[SYSTEM: Analyzing Dying Subject...]

[Species: Phantom-Silk Butterfly (Mutated)]

[Status: Soul-Collapse (92% Complete)]

[Hidden Truth: This is not a common butterfly. It is a 'Void-Caterpillar' that failed its first evolution due to a lack of Spatial Essence.]

"I won't replace it," Leo said, his voice ringing through the silent hall. "A Breeder doesn't choose only the strong. We find the strength that others throw away."

The Miracle of the Void

Leo ignored the timers. He didn't use the standard Alliance nutrients. Instead, he pulled a small vial of Moon-Shadow Salt from his pocket and bit his own thumb, letting a drop of his blood—rich with the Void-Dragon's resonance—fall onto the butterfly.

"System, spend 1,500 Points. Enchantment: Soul-Anchor. Activate Path: 'Nebula Monarch'."

[DING!]

[1,500 System Points Consumed.]

[Triggering Primordial Evolution: Death-to-Life Inversion.]

Leo began a complex mana-circulation. He didn't try to heal the wings; he let them wither away entirely.

"He's killing it!" someone screamed.

But as the wings crumbled into dust, a brilliant violet cocoon formed around the butterfly's body. The air in the hall began to vibrate. The Void-Drifter Snail on Leo's shoulder pulsed in sync with the cocoon.

CRACK.

The cocoon shattered. Out flew a creature that defied the laws of the Alliance. It had four wings made of shimmering, starlight-infused silk. Everywhere it flew, it left a trail of silver dust that healed the nearby plants in the hall.

[Evolved Species: Nebula Soul-Monarch (Grade-B / Rare)]

[Ability: 'Stardust Restoration' – Can heal the mana-cores of other pets.]

The dying insect had become a Grade-B miracle.

The Invitation of a Master

The hall was dead silent until Master Silas stood up and began to clap. Soon, the entire audience followed.

"Perfect Distinction," Silas announced, his voice trembling with emotion. "In forty years, I have never seen a 'Death-Inversion' evolution executed by a Junior."

After the ceremony, as Leo was receiving his Gold-Trimmed Junior License, Silas approached him privately in the garden.

"Leo Heart," Silas said, bowing slightly—a shocking gesture from a Master-Breeder. "I am Silas Thorne. I have spent my life searching for the 'Ancient Harmony' in breeding. Today, you didn't just pass an exam; you showed me a path I thought was lost."

Silas looked at Leo with genuine kindness. "I am the Head of the Alliance Research Wing. I would like to formally invite you to be my Personal Disciple. I have no interest in your family name—only in your hands and your heart. I can give you access to the Forbidden Archives and materials that even the Heart Guild cannot find."

Leo looked at the older man. Through his Insight, he saw that Silas's soul was steady and righteous, filled with a pure love for beasts.

"I accept, Master Silas," Leo said, bowing back. "I have much to learn about this world's hidden history."

"Good," Silas smiled, handing him a silver badge with a dragon-eye insignia. "Our first lesson starts tomorrow. We are going to investigate the SSS-Rank 'Abyssal Trench' records. I believe your new 'Butterfly' and that 'Snail' of yours are the keys to a door I've been trying to open for decades."
